Aviva invites agencies to pitch for its £4m online account

Aviva, the owner of Norwich Union and the RAC, is looking for a digital agency to handle online advertising and website-building duties across both businesses.

The company has approached 15 agencies to tender for the £4 million account, which will cover Norwich Union Insurance, Norwich Union Life and all of the RAC.

The longlist will be cut down to a shortlist of between four and six agencies. AKQA, the incumbent on the account, has been asked to re-pitch. This process is expected to finish in mid-November.

The hunt for a new agency follows Aviva's decision in June to restructure the digital departments of both businesses and to create a combined digital marketing division.

A significant part of the brief for the winning agency will be to improve customer engagement services and self-service facilities for both businesses.
